According to the public record, 4, Moss Lane, Bootle is a period leasehold house with 2,464 ft2 of internal area.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 5 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 4, Moss Lane, Bootle is £283,023 and the estimated rental value is £1,482 per month.
Moss Lane, Bootle, L20 is located in the borough of Sefton within the L20 postal district.
4, Moss Lane, Bootle has 21 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in December 2014 and a single entry in the EPC database dated November 2022.
We combine this information with that of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 1 out of 5 and is considered of low accuracy.
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 4, Moss Lane, Bootle is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£297,174 and a rental value of £1,556 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£263,211 and a rental value of £1,378 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 4 Moss Lane Bootle has increased by an estimated £5,412 (1.9%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£53 per month (3.5%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.3%.
4, Moss Lane, Bootle has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 26 Nov 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 4, Moss Lane, Bootle was last sold on 4th December 2014 for £202,500 and was recorded as a leaseh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
